The Westford Conservation Commission held a meeting on June 10, 2026, focusing primarily on environmental and infrastructure projects within the town. Key procurement-related discussions included the Colonial Drive bridge repair project, where the town is funding a trenchless rehabilitation method to extend the culvert's service life, and the release of RFPs for Hill Orchard and Day Farm conservation projects, which were pending release at the time. The commission also reviewed multiple public hearings concerning property developments near wetlands, tree removal requests due to safety and health concerns, and septic system installations, with several motions passed to continue hearings or issue conditional determinations. Additionally, the commission addressed enforcement orders, compliance updates, and the appointment of a commissioner to an Environmental Bond Committee working group. The meeting included detailed technical discussions on project impacts, environmental protections, and construction timelines, emphasizing minimizing ecological disturbance and ensuring regulatory compliance.
